Comparing Dexter 6,000 Lb Trailer Brakes, 23-105-106 and 23-105-106-09  

Question:

What is the difference between the Dexter Trailer Brakes - 23-105-106-09 kit with 23-105-09 and 23-105-09 vs what is installed on my trailer 23-105-00 and 23-106-00? 2x12 Drum Brake backers. Thanks

0

Expert Reply:

The only difference between the Dexter Electric Trailer Brake Kit part # 23-105-106 and Dexter Electric Trailer Brake Kit part # 23-105-106-09 is fit. The former works on Dexter or Lippert axles with a five bolt bracket mounting flange whereas the latter works on Dexter or Lippert axles with a five bolt bracket mounting flange as well as AL-KO/Hayes axles with a four bolt bracket mounting flange. If you have a Dexter or Lippert axle with a five bolt bracket mounting flange you can use either though I do still recommend the former as it's more cost effective.
